Tomato Ban: Act Now or Say Goodbye to Your Office – FABAG to Agric Ministry

Summary by MyNewsGh
The Ministry of Food and Agriculture has been tasked to quickly to address the tomato shortage, warning that failure to do so would call the Ministry’s relevance into question. The warning was issued by The Food and Beverages Association of Ghana (FABAG) has urge in a statement released on Monday.
